Localization of mannan at the surface of yeast protoplasts by scanning electron microscopy
Authors:Marc Horisberger  Jacqueline Rosset  Heinz Bauer
Institution:(1) Research Department, Nestlé Products Technical Assistance Co. Ltd., CH-1814 La Tour-de-Peilz, Switzerland;(2) Present address: NORDRECO AB, S-267 00 Bjuv, Sweden
Abstract:The beta(1rarr3)glucanase of Basidiomycete QM 806 was used to prepare Saccharomyces cerevisiae and Candida utilis protoplasts. Plasma membranes isolated from S. cerevisiae contained a small amount of mannose and traces of glucose and ribose. Randomly distributed agr-mannan was detected by scanning electron microscopy at the surface of prefixed protoplasts using colloidal gold labelled with Concanavalin A as a marker. C. utilis protoplasts were also marked with anti-mannan antibodies. Again the distribution of mannan was random. This experiment indicated also that plasma membrane mannan has the same immunochemical determinants as cell wall mannan. It is hypothesized that mannan is mainly located in the outer layer of plasma membranes.
